    to answer a previous question- i have not used noise reduction in these new mixes.
    i didn't have to as the multitracks were in pretty good condition . and also by muting tracks that weren't being used while mixing i found that the noise level was acceptable.
    you will notice that some sections are slighlty noisier than the 94 remasters.

    Product Description
    Lavish 2007 twelve disc box featuring the first five installments in the Genesis remaster campaign (each double disc installment is digitally remastered and features a Hybrid SACD + NTSC/Region 0 DVD), a 48 page case-bound book PLUS an exclusive bonus double disc set featuring an additional 13 non-album tracks (only available in this box)! This bonus double disc is also in the hybrid SACD plus PAL DVD format. The SACD features 13 remastered audio tracks on an SACD Hybrid disc which is playable on both normal CD and SACD 5.1 Surround players. The DVD features the same 13 audio tracks in DTS 5.1 Surround Sound plus two rare video extras including a music clip and an interview. From their Progressive Rock beginnings to their commercial superstardom, Genesis created some of the most challenging, creative and rewarding albums of their generation. This special edition not only offers bonus material, but also allows the listener to experience the album as never before! EMI.

    Basically there will be no box set release containing an NTSC DVD for each album and a PAL DVD for the bonus DVD or vice-versa; it's either all NTSC or all PAL. Additionally, the product description at Amazon.com for the Asian boxset is copied exactly from the product description for the European box set. Someone forgot to change the second PAL reference to NTSC. . .that is all. This is also covered on page 22 of this thread. You'll notice at sites like BarnesandNoble and BestBuy (see list below) they are also selling the NTSC box set for the same price of $309.99. I have no idea why these stores are being told the box set is going to be that expensive. . .I am convinced there is some kind of miscommunication and the price will drop. CDUniverse is selling the Asian boxset for ~$150 as a comparison and the Genesis official shop at about $160-$170 depending on exchange rates.
